Since diamond have high refractive index (about 2.4) , the critical angle for total internal reflection is only 25o . Incident light , therefore strikes many of the internal faces before it strikes one at less than 25o and emerges .After such many reflections , the light has traveled far enough that the colours have become sufficiently separated to be seen individually and brilliantly.This makes diamonds glitter.

It depends on the type of igneous rock. Intrusive igneous rocks such as granite have large crystals, extrusive igneous rocks may have small crystals as in basalt or no crystals as in pumice.
